Secretary. Shall be responsible for recording the activities of ERYFA and maintain appropriate files, mailing lists and necessary records.

 

The Secretary shall:

  1. Maintain a list of all Officers, Level Directors and Members and key contacts.
  2. Give notice to the Board of Directors of all meetings of ERYFA and the agenda for such meetings.
  3. Keep the minutes of the meetings of the Board of Directors, and cause them to be recorded and kept for that purpose.
  4. Prepare and receive all correspondence and other written tasks on behalf of the President, Board of Directors and ERYFA. Act as single point of contact between appropriate Agencies, and the various ERYFA programs to procure facilities for meetings, outdoor tryouts, outdoor practices and other special events.
  5. Prepare and run all registrations for ERYFA with help of the Communications Director.
  6. Attend and participate in ERYFA Board meetings.
  7. Attend and participate in at least 75% of regular ERYFA Board Meetings, and must attend all season start-up events and trainings.
  8. Check the ERYFA post office at regular intervals; weekly June to October and no less than monthly November to May.
  9. Assure and maintain appropriate regulations and procedures for outgoing emails, from or on the behalf of ERYFA.
